About the role
About The Job
A problem isn’t truly solved until it’s solved for all. That’s why Googlers build products that help create opportunities for everyone, whether down the street or across the globe. As a Program Manager at Google, you’ll lead complex, multi-disciplinary projects from start to finish — working with stakeholders to plan requirements, manage project schedules, identify risks, and communicate clearly with cross-functional partners across the company. Your projects will often span offices, time zones, and hemispheres. It's your job to coordinate the players and keep them up to date on progress and deadlines.As the Business Analytics and Reporting Lead, you will serve as the strategic investigative engine for the rapidly expanding Greenfield portfolio. You will convert complex project data into actionable, defensive intelligence to drive predictability across cost and schedule baselines. By performing advanced probabilistic risk assessments and leading high-level program health reviews with executive leadership, you will translate raw data into strategic scenarios that guide critical decision-making. You will also act as a vital cross-functional liaison between Finance and Internal Audit, ensuring procedural compliance and implementing automated process improvements to support the increasing scale of global infrastructure operations.

Responsibilities
- Establish and maintain complex analytics comparing design configuration baselines against risk-informed forecasts and industry trends to identify portfolio-level headroom.
- Perform advanced probability analyses to quantify cost/schedule exposure and execute rapid-response data analytics on anomalies to support urgent "what-if" scenario planning.
- Lead the facilitation of monthly program health reviews with executive leadership, translating intricate technical data sets into high-level strategic insights and action items.
- Identify bottlenecks in data workflows to implement automated solutions for scalability, serving as the primary investigative lead for internal audits and procedural compliance.

- What are the key responsibilities for a Business Analytics and Reporting Lead at Google?
- As a Business Analytics and Reporting Lead at Google, you will be responsible for establishing analytics to compare design baselines with forecasts, performing advanced probability analyses for cost/schedule exposure, leading program health reviews with executive leadership, and identifying/implementing automated solutions for data workflows and internal audits.
- What qualifications are essential for the Business Analytics and Reporting Lead role at Google?
- Essential qualifications include a Bachelor's degree in a quantitative field or equivalent experience, 8 years in program/project management, 7 years in project controls/business analytics/financial planning, 5 years in construction risk portfolios, and 3 years facilitating executive-level health reviews.
- What preferred qualifications would make a candidate stand out for this Google role?
- Preferred qualifications include experience in mission-critical data center programs, dashboard ideation, advanced reporting tools, construction schedule analytics (Primavera P6), Earned Value Management (EVM), and identifying/automating manual process bottlenecks.
- How does Google approach hiring for roles like Business Analytics and Reporting Lead, considering location preferences?
- Google allows applicants to share their preferred working location from a list of sites like Addison, TX, Kirkland, WA, New York, NY, Reston, VA, San Francisco, CA, and Sunnyvale, CA. Your recruiter will discuss these options during the hiring process.
- What is the salary range for the Business Analytics and Reporting Lead position at Google in the US?
- The US base salary range for this full-time position is $189,000-$274,000, not including bonus, equity, or benefits. Actual pay is determined by factors like role, level, location, skills, and experience.
